#f68051 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#f68051 is composed of 96.5% red, 50.2% green and 31.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 48% magenta, 67.1% yellow and 3.5% black. It has a hue angle of 17.1 degrees, a saturation of 90.2% and a lightness of 64.1%. #f68051 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ffa2 with #ed0100. Closest websafe color is: #ff9966.

Shades and Tints of #f68051

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0401 is the darkest color, while #fffbf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#f68051

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a9a19e is the less saturated color, while #fd7d4a is the most saturated one.
